The last two years have witnessed a proliferation of acronyms in the corruption landscape. In this simplified table, ANN brings you a current list of terms and acronyms along with a succinct description of each.
GYEEDA | The payment of over GH¢1B to various friends and families for no value received |
SUBAH | The IT company paid over GH¢144M for monitoring services that it could not provide |
SADA | An investment of GH¢15M that yielded 6 “dual citizen akomfems.” |
FORTIZ | The friends and families who acquired a 90% stake in Merchant Bank for GH¢90M after an offer from Rand to buy 75% stake for GH¢176.4M had been rejected. |
E&P | The company, owned by the President’s brother, that owes Merchant Bank GH¢175M and has not made a payment since 2009. |
ISOFOTON | The company paid $1.3M in judgment debt for no value received |
CHRAJ | The Ombudsman that was castrated by the appointment of a political baby. |
WATERVILLE | The company that was paid $47M in judgment debt for no value received. |
Tony LOOTER | The man who controls 3 ministries, sits on several Boards and is legal counsel for the President and Austro Invest, the fictitious company that wanted part of the proceeds paid to Waterville |
AAL | The friends and family owned company that is demanding GH¢618 for supplying cars and services to the ministries. |
BARTON | The man whose role in paying Woyome was rewarded with a promotion to the Deputy Speaker of Parliament |

KABA MOULD | Attorney General of Judgment Debt |
EMBRAER | The committee set up by President Mills to investigate Vice-President Mahama for his role in the negotiation and purchase of over-invoiced military aircrafts from Brazil. |
JUSPONG | The Zoomlion of Raiding the Treasury. Involved in so many questionable transactions. |
BGMS | Managed to borrow from Government at 0% interest rate and loaned the proceeds to government at 1,200% interest rate. |
RLG | The Ali Baaba of the National Treasury. |
JD 600 | Refers to the over GH¢600M Judgment Debt paid by Mills/Mahama in 3 years. |
